Mediatek Dimensity 9500 vs Snapdragon 8 Elite
vs
In this comparison, we take a closer look at two SoCs, Mediatek Dimensity 9500 vs Snapdragon 8 Elite, based on their benchmarks and specifications. The Mediatek Dimensity 9500 comes with an octa-core CPU paired with an Arm Mali-G1 Ultra MC12 GPU, while the Snapdragon 8 Elite comes with an octa-core CPU and the Adreno 830 GPU.
Why Mediatek Dimensity 9500 is better than Snapdragon 8 Elite
- 26% higher AnTuTu score (3.58M vs 2.84M)
- Newer CPU architecture (ARMv9.3-A vs ARMv9.2-A)
- 56% higher compute performance (5.271 vs 3.37 TFLOPS)
- Released 11 months later - (september 2025 vs October 2024)
Why Snapdragon 8 Elite is better than Mediatek Dimensity 9500
- 3% Faster CPU clock speed (4320 MHz vs 4210 MHz)

General
| SoC Name | Mediatek Dimensity 9500 | Snapdragon 8 Elite |
| Launch Date | september 2025 | October 2024 |
| Class | Flagship | Flagship |
| Model Number | MT6993 | SM8750-AB, SM8750-AC |
| Manufacturing | TSMC | TSMC |
CPU
| Core Configuration | 1x 4.21 GHz - C1-Ultra 3x 3.50 GHz - C1-Premium 4x 2.70 GHz - C1-Pro |
2× 4.32 GHz - Oryon (Phoenix L) 6× 3.53 GHz - Oryon (Phoenix M) |
| CPU Cores | 8 | 8 |
| Max Clock Speed | 4210 MHz | 4320 MHz |
| Architecture | ARMv9.3-A | ARMv9.2-A |
| L2 Cache | 2 MB | 12 MB |
| L3 Cache | 16 MB | 8 MB |
| Process Node | 3 nm | 3 nm |
| TDP | - | 8 W |
GPU
| GPU | Arm Mali-G1 Ultra MC12 | Adreno 830 |
| GPU Architecture | 5th Gen Valhall Architecture | Adreno 800 |
| GPU Frequency | 1716 MHz | 1100 MHz |
| Neural Processing Unit | MediaTek NPU 990 | Hexagon NPU |
| Shading Units | 128 | 512 |
| Compute Performance | 5.271 TFLOPS | 3.37 TFLOPS |
| Ray Tracing Support | Yes | Yes |
| Max Refresh Rate | 180 Hz at WQHD+ | 240 Hz |
| Vulkan | 1.4 | 1.3 |
| OpenCL | 3.0 | 3.0 |
| DirectX | 12.1 | 12.1 |
Memory & Storage
| Memory Type | LPDDR5X | LPDDR5X |
| Frequency | 5333 MHz | Up to 5300 MHz |
| Bus | 4x16-bit channels | 4x16-bit channels |
| Max Bandwidth | 85.3 GB/s | 84.8 GB/s |
| Max RAM Size | 24 GB | 24 GB |
| Storage Type | UFS 4.1 | UFS 4.1 |
